The gameplay mechanics of Possibility Storm are complex and game-altering. When a player casts a spell from their hand, the enchantment immediately exiles that spell. It then continues to exile cards from the top of their library one by one until it finds a card that shares a card type with the original spell. The player is then permitted to cast that newly revealed card without paying its mana cost, effectively bypassing traditional resource constraints. Once the effect resolves, all cards exiled during the process are shuffled back into the bottom of the library in a random order. This unique interaction creates moments of high volatility and strategic unpredictability, which is why collectors often seek out copies of this card from the Dragon's Maze set. The ability to potentially cast multiple spells for the cost of one makes it a cornerstone in various deck strategies, despite its high mana cost of five generic mana and two red mana. Card Text
Abilities, attacks, oracle text, and flavor text printed on the card.
Whenever a player casts a spell from their hand, that player exiles it, then exiles cards from the top of their library until they exile a card that shares a card type with it. That player may cast that card without paying its mana cost. Then they put all cards exiled with this enchantment on the bottom of their library in a random order.
